Technological Innovation and Digital Transformation in the Medical Foods Market
The clinical nutrition industry is experiencing a technological renaissance, driven by advances in nutrigenomics, drug delivery systems, and digital health platforms. The Medical Foods Market is at the forefront of these innovations, valued at USD 28.64 billion in 2025 and projected to reach USD 56.18 billion by 2035 at a CAGR of 5.48%. This article explores the technological innovations reshaping the clinical nutrition landscape.
The Technology Transformation
Legacy one-size-fits-all powders are giving way to precision-formulated soft-gel capsules and lipid-based enteral nutrition therapy systems that improve bioavailability for neurological and renal applications. The technology transition is driven by the need for more effective, targeted nutritional interventions. Modern medical foods incorporate advanced delivery systems, nutrigenomic insights, and digital health integration for optimized patient outcomes.
The integration of digital technologies is enabling more personalized and accessible clinical nutrition. The European Commission's revision of regulations allocated substantial funding for clinical validation, signaling regulatory intent to elevate these products closer to pharmaceutical-grade oversight.

Advanced Delivery Systems
Soft-Gel Bioavailability Enhancement
Soft-gel capsules are forecast to post the fastest segment CAGR at 8.12%, driven by lipid-based delivery systems enhancing bioavailability for neurological and renal applications. Lipid-based delivery enhances absorption of fat-soluble vitamins critical for disease-specific nutritional formulas. Soft-gel technology is a key area of innovation.
Enteral Nutrition Therapy Systems
Enteral nutrition therapy delivery systems are becoming more portable and user-friendly for home care settings. Pump-compatible formulations enable home-based enteral feeding. Enteral technology is essential for home care expansion.
Microencapsulation Technologies
Microencapsulation of bitter active compounds and texture optimization improves palatability and patient compliance. Compliance rates improve significantly with palatability-enhanced formulations. Microencapsulation is a key formulation technology.
